Cast Marion Cotillard, Matthias Schoenaerts, Armand Verdure, Céline Sallette, Corinne Masiero, Bouli Lanners, Jean-Michel Correia.
Credits Director of photography, Stéphane Fontaine ; editor, Juliette Welfling ; original music, Alexandre Desplat.
Note Based on the short story by Craig Davidson.
Originally released as a motion picture in 2012.
Summary A homeless father and street boxer struggling to support his son and a horribly injured killer whale trainer's lives intersect and form an intensifying bond that fractures the considerable defensive armor each is accustomed to wearing.
Note Special features include commentary, making of featurette, VFX breakdown by Mikros, On the red carpet at the Toronto International Film Festival, deleted scenes and trailer.
Awards NOMINEE: Best Actress, Screen Actors Guild (Marion Cotillard) -- 2 Critics' Choice Award Nominations -- WINNER: Best Actress, Hollywood Film Awards (Marion Cotillard) -- Competition, Festival de Cannes -- NOMINEE: Best Foreign Language Film & Best Actress - Drama, Golden Globe.
